Database agency Merkle has hired Chris Crayner to serve as senior VP of customer management strategy. Crayner’s responsibilities include developing market strategy for Merkle clients.
Crayner joins Merkle from The Walt Disney Company, where he held technology-related positions in brand and customer relationship management, as well as its business intelligence operations. Crayner was most recently vice president of global customer managed relationships at Disney Parks and Resorts in Orlando.
Before joining Disney, Crayner was the director of e-business and marketing, technical service at Bristol Myers Squibb Co. At Bristol-Myers, he led the company’s e-business strategy.
